media: saa7134: use sg_dma_len when building pgtable
[ Upstream commit 4e1cb753c04d74e06d7ca826ea0bcb02526af03e ] The new AMD IOMMU DMA implementation concatenates sglist entries under certain conditions, and because saa7134 accessed the length member directly, it did not support this scenario. This fixes IO_PAGE_FAULTs and choppy DMA audio by using the sg_dma_len macro.
